Output 69596b4e833cd88a738f91662bf40b485bef65afc3f45a95f24c8ef0730db713:8

value
63435859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6267e7007faff5f1717e1801e0f2cdabbc811c05 OP_EQUAL
address
MGsUvVTfxQHWW2FaGbswFEqNfGALNxnsdu
transaction
69596b4e833cd88a738f91662bf40b485bef65afc3f45a95f24c8ef0730db713
spent
true